    Search has been becoming smarter for years (decades?) by now.

    The problem is that search has been made to work with the “you know what I mean” factor… fixing spelling mistakes, considering different tenses or forms of words, including related words…

    Search became more friendly to the average non-technical user, but it became harder for users who know/knew how to search for exactly what they want.

    Other factors include…

    • Search Engine Optimization (SEO) where websites try to appear for as many searches as possible, occasionally regardless of relevance
    • Monetization of search, where people with SEO and a lot of money pay to be included in as many “relevant” searches as possible
    • AI incorporated into search by trying to find additional relevant pages
    • Search engines being reluctant to return zero (or few) results and padding the results with other things you “might be interested in”
    • Also, search trying to use what you “might be interested in” based on what they know about you/your account/your IP address/your location based on your IP range.
